Sugar free vanilla skyr has a glycemic index of 35 (Low) and a glycemic load of 1 per 100 g.
Sugar free vanilla skyr has a low glycemic index (35), making it a good option for people with insulin resistance. It causes a slow, gradual rise in blood sugar.
Sugar free vanilla skyr has the lowest glycemic load of all forms of Skyr (icelandic yogurt) in this database (1 per 100 g).
